Output 30a81d90dbac1ab9e3d4bd8067d9f49177fcb93558a2b1042bfd29a8dc1bfb27:8

value
20893447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c184aaaca57c1018109cc5a5b94ac695a3565ae OP_EQUAL
address
MN8WkAqfHXF6Ac5ZTQDWixjBrvvKjuotJp
transaction
30a81d90dbac1ab9e3d4bd8067d9f49177fcb93558a2b1042bfd29a8dc1bfb27
spent
true